Comprehending Composite Doors

Before delving into the replacement procedure, it's necessary to understand the special characteristics of composite doors.  similar web-site  are made from a combination of products, typically consisting of wood, plastic, and often metal. This mix of materials offers improved resilience, insulation, and resistance to weathering. The locks on composite doors are often more robust and sophisticated than those on conventional wood doors, making them an important component in home security.

Tools and Materials Needed

To replace a composite door lock, you will require the following tools and materials:

  • New lock set: Ensure it works with your composite door.
  • Screwdriver set: Both flathead and Phillips.
  • Drill and drill bits: For developing brand-new holes if needed.
  • Determining tape: To determine the existing lock and ensure the new one fits.
  • Pencil: For marking measurements and drilling points.
  • Chisel: For expanding or producing new holes.
  • Utility knife: For trimming any excess product.
  • Lock lube: To ensure smooth operation of the new lock.

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ing a Composite Door Lock

Prepare the Workspace

  • Clear the area around the door to ensure you have adequate area to work.
  • Eliminate any ornamental trim or hardware that may interfere with the replacement procedure.

Get Rid Of the Old Lock

  • Exterior Handle: Use a screwdriver to get rid of the screws holding the exterior handle in location. Pull the handle far from the door.
  • Interior Handle: Similarly, remove the screws from the interior handle and pull it far from the door.
  • Lock Cylinder: If the old lock has a different cylinder, remove the screws protecting it to the door and pull it out. If it's incorporated with the handle, it must bring out the handle.
  • Latch Mechanism: Remove the screws holding the latch system in place. Slide the lock out of the door.

Step and Prepare for the New Lock

  • Procedure the Existing Holes: Use a measuring tape to determine the size and position of the existing holes. This will help you select a suitable brand-new lock set.
  • Mark the New Holes: If the brand-new lock requires various hole positionings, use a pencil to mark the new positions on the door.
  • Drill New Holes: Use a drill and the proper drill bits to develop brand-new holes. For larger holes, you might require to use a sculpt to enlarge the existing ones.

Install the New Lock

  • Latch Mechanism: Insert the new latch mechanism into the door and secure it with screws.
  • Lock Cylinder: If the new lock has a different cylinder, insert it into the door and secure it with screws.
  • Exterior Handle: Align the brand-new exterior handle with the holes and insert the screws. Tighten the screws to secure the handle.
  • Interior Handle: Repeat the process for the interior handle, guaranteeing it aligns with the exterior handle and the lock mechanism.
  • Test the Lock: Turn the deals with and test the lock to guarantee it runs efficiently. If  composite door lock replacements  feels stiff, use a percentage of lock lube.

Last Touches

  • Reattach Trim and Hardware: Replace any decorative trim or hardware that was eliminated.
  • Check the Door: Open and close the door numerous times to ensure the brand-new lock is functioning correctly which the door aligns effectively in the frame.

FAQs

Q: Can I change a composite door lock myself, or should I employ a professional?A: While replacing a composite door lock is a task that many property owners can carry out with the right tools and assistance, it can be more complicated than replacing a lock on a standard wood door. If you are not positive in your abilities or if the lock is part of a sophisticated security system, it might be wise to employ a professional locksmith professional.

Q: What should I search for when choosing a brand-new lock for my composite door?A: When choosing a new lock, consider the following:

  • Compatibility: Ensure the brand-new lock is suitable with your composite door.
  • Security Features: Look for locks with high-security functions such as deadbolts, anti-pick systems, and reinforced cylinders.
  • Durability: Choose a lock made from high-quality products to guarantee durability.
  • Aesthetic appeals: Select a lock that complements the design and finish of your composite door.

Q: How often should I change the lock on my composite door?A: The life expectancy of a lock can vary depending on use and maintenance. Usually, it's an excellent idea to change a lock every 5-10 years or sooner if you notice signs of wear, such as difficulty in turning the crucial or a loose handle.

Q: Can I use a standard lock on a composite door?A: While basic locks can be used on composite doors, it's recommended to utilize locks particularly developed for composite doors. These locks are generally more robust and much better fit to the unique building and construction of composite doors.
